Ted Stevens Anchorage International Airport
- Total Cost: $400 Million
- New: 491,000 sq feet
- Renovated: 350,000 sq feet
- 2005 IIDA Regional Award of Merit Winner Lighting Design
- 2005 IIDA Section Award Winner Lighting Design
- Architect: McCool Carlson Green
- Owner: State of Alaska, Department of Transportation & Public Facilities
Anchorage International Airport Airfield Maintenance Building
- Total Cost: $18 Million
- New: 114,300 sq feet
- Architect: USKH
- Owner: State of Alaska, Department of Transportation & Public Facilities

Alaska Railroad Anchorage Operations Center
- Total Cost: $6 Million
- New: 22,741 sq feet
- Architect: Architects Alaska
- Owner: Alaska Railroad Corporation
